Slim Dusty ’ A Pub With No Beer’ Original 1957 Version 45 rpm

Slim Dusty and the original version of his worldwide million selling 1957/58 hit. The label also credits Dick Carr and His Bushlanders, I think they’d gone off to find some beer during the recording. UK #3 In 2000 Slim recorded his 100th album, the first commercial artist ever to do this (Cliff Richard has also achieved the feat subsequently) and uniquely all for the same label EMI. Slim sang Waltzing Matilda at the closing ceremony of the 2000 Sydney Olympics, Slim died in 2003. The b side ’Once when I was mustering’ also uploaded
